DirectionsStep1In a large bowl, combine the oats, ground flaxseed, chia seeds, cinnamon, and salt.Step2Place the almond butter in a small microwave safe bowl. Heat in the microwave for 20-30 seconds. You want it to be soft and slightly melted. Stir until smooth.Step3Add the honey and vanilla extract to the melted almond butter. Stir until smooth. Pour over the oat mixture and stir until well combined. Stir in the raisins.Step4Roll the mixture into small balls, about 1-2 tablespoons per ball. Place in an airtight container and keep refrigerated for up to 2 weeks.Step5Note-if you don't like raisins, you can use dried cranberries or chocolate chips instead.
